LANDSLIDE IN PERU

OVER HUNDRED KILLED

LIMA, March 27.

Dispatches .from thp Province of Trujillo today state that relief workers recovered the bodies of 76 persons killed on-Sunday under a landslide at the village of Tantaday.

It is reported that more than 120 persons were killed by the slide,-which '■ was caused by heavy rain. .
